Researchers at Cedars-Sinai Health Sciences University and Johns Hopkins University have identified genetic mutations that may explain why some people develop a spontaneous c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) leak in the spine. The findings, published in The Lancet Neurology, may lead to earlier diagnosis and more targeted treatments for the painful and often disabling condition.
